WebOn your computer, go to Gmail. Click Compose. Click Attach . Choose the files you want to upload. In the bottom right of the window, click Turn on confidential mode . Tip: If you've already turned on confidential mode for an email, go to the bottom of the email, then click Edit. Set an expiration date and passcode. WebJul 17, 2015 · There is also a risk that the email with the encrypted attachment will be part of a conversation, perhaps involving new parties, and that would leak the password if it was included in quoted text. A separate email avoids this risk as well. But relying on a password sent by email is not good. Sending the password by some other means is an ...
